Foot Ulcer Sensors Market Size Growth Analysis: Regional Trends and Share Outlook 2024-2032

The global healthcare industry is witnessing a significant transformation with the integration of advanced technologies, and one of the most promising developments is the rise of foot ulcer sensors. These innovative devices are designed to monitor and detect early signs of foot ulcers, particularly in patients with diabetes, enabling timely intervention and reducing the risk of severe complications. As the prevalence of diabetes continues to rise worldwide, the demand for effective monitoring solutions like foot ulcer sensors is expected to grow substantially.

Market Size and Growth Projections

The Foot Ulcer Sensors Market Size was valued at USD 163.03 million in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 224.46 million by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.62% during the forecast period of 2024-2032. This growth is driven by the increasing incidence of diabetes, the rising awareness of diabetic foot complications, and the growing adoption of wearable medical devices. The market's expansion is also fueled by technological advancements in sensor technology, which have made these devices more accurate, affordable, and user-friendly.

Drivers of Market Growth

One of the primary factors driving the growth of the foot ulcer sensors market is the global increase in diabetes cases. According to the International Diabetes Federation (IDF), over 537 million adults were living with diabetes in 2021, and this number is expected to rise to 643 million by 2030. Diabetic patients are at a higher risk of developing foot ulcers due to neuropathy and poor circulation, making early detection crucial. Foot ulcer sensors provide a non-invasive and continuous monitoring solution, helping patients and healthcare providers manage this condition more effectively.

Additionally, the growing adoption of wearable health technologies is contributing to market growth. Consumers are increasingly embracing devices that offer real-time health monitoring, and foot ulcer sensors are no exception. These sensors are often integrated into smart socks, insoles, or wearable patches, making them convenient and discreet for everyday use. The integration of IoT (Internet of Things) and AI (Artificial Intelligence) technologies further enhances their functionality, enabling data analysis and personalized recommendations for patients.

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ite the promising growth prospects, the foot ulcer sensors market faces certain challenges. High costs associated with advanced sensor technologies and limited awareness in developing regions may hinder market expansion. However, ongoing research and development efforts are focused on reducing production costs and improving accessibility, which could address these barriers in the coming years.

On the other hand, the market presents significant opportunities for innovation and collaboration. Partnerships between healthcare providers, technology companies, and research institutions are likely to accelerate the development of next-generation foot ulcer sensors. Moreover, government initiatives aimed at improving diabetes care and reducing healthcare burdens are expected to create a favorable environment for market growth.

Regional Insights

Geographically, North America currently dominates the foot ulcer sensors market, owing to the high prevalence of diabetes,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and strong adoption of wearable technologies. Europe follows closely, with increasing investments in diabetes management and preventive care.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is expected to witness the fastest growth during the forecast period, driven by rising diabetes cases, improving healthcare access, and growing awareness of foot ulcer prevention.

Conclusion

The foot ulcer sensors market is poised for steady growth over the next decade, driven by the increasing global burden of diabetes and the rising demand for innovative healthcare solutions. With advancements in sensor technology and the growing adoption of wearable devices, foot ulcer sensors are set to play a critical role in improving patient outcomes and reducing healthcare costs. As the market continues to evolve, stakeholders must focus on addressing challenges and leveraging opportunities to unlock its full potential, ultimately contributing to a healthier future for millions of patients worldwide.

Semiconductor Chip Market Size and Demand Forecast: Trends & Dynamics 2024-2032

The semiconductor chip market is at the heart of the global technology revolution, powering everything from smartphones and computers to electric vehicles and advanced artificial intelligence systems. As the world becomes increasingly digital, the demand for semiconductors continues to surge, making this industry one of the most critical and dynamic sectors in the global economy. With rapid advancements in technology and the proliferation of connected devices, the semiconductor chip market is poised for significant growth over the coming years.

Market Size and Growth Projections

The Semiconductor Chip Market Size was valued at USD 640.3 billion in 2023, reflecting its immense scale and importance. This market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.38% from 2024 to 2031, reaching a staggering USD 1219 billion by 2031. This growth is driven by the increasing adoption of emerging technologies such as 5G, the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), and autonomous vehicles, all of which rely heavily on advanced semiconductor components. Additionally, the ongoing digital transformation across industries, including healthcare, automotive, and consumer electronics, is fueling demand for more powerful and efficient chips.

Key Drivers of Market Growth

Several factors are contributing to the robust growth of the semiconductor chip market. First, the rollout of 5G networks worldwide is creating a surge in demand for high-performance chips capable of supporting faster data speeds and lower latency. Second, the rise of AI and machine learning applications is driving the need for specialized semiconductors, such as graphics processing units (GPUs) and tensor processing units (TPUs), which are essential for processing vast amounts of data. Third, the automotive industry's shift toward elect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ous driving technologies is significantly increasing the demand for semiconductors, as these vehicles rely on advanced sensors, processors, and power management systems.

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ite the optimistic growth outlook, the semiconductor chip market faces several challenges. Supply chain disruptions, geopolitical tensions, and the complexity of manufacturing advanced chips are some of the key hurdles that the industry must navigate. The global chip shortage experienced in recent years highlighted the vulnerabilities in the supply chain and underscored the need for greater investment in semiconductor manufacturing capacity. However, these challenges also present opportunities for innovation and collaboration. Governments and private companies are increasingly investing in domestic chip production facilities to reduce reliance on foreign suppliers, while advancements in chip design and materials are paving the way for more efficient and powerful semiconductors.

Regional Insights

The semiconductor chip market is geographically diverse, with key players and manufacturing hubs located across the globe. Asia-Pacific dominates the market, accounting for a significant share of global production and consumption, driven by countries like China, South Korea, and Taiwan. North America and Europe are also major players, with a strong focus on research and development, particularly in cutting-edge technologies such as AI and quantum computing. As the demand for semiconductors continues to grow, regional investments in infrastructure and talent development will play a crucial role in shaping the future of the industry.

Future Outlook

The semiconductor chip market is set to remain a cornerstone of technological progress, enabling innovations that will transform industries and improve lives. As the world moves toward a more connected and intelligent future, the importance of semiconductors will only continue to grow. Companies that can adapt to the evolving landscape, invest in next-generation technologies, and address supply chain challenges will be well-positioned to capitalize on the immense opportunities in this dynamic market.

In conclusion, the semiconductor chip market's projected growth to USD 1219 billion by 2031 underscores its critical role in the global economy. With a CAGR of 8.38% over the forecast period, the industry is on a trajectory of sustained expansion, driven by technological advancements and increasing demand across sectors. As the digital revolution accelerates, the semiconductor chip market will remain at the forefront of innovation, shaping the future of technology and connectivity.

Artificial Intelligence (AI) Sensor Market Size & Industry Dynamics: Demand and Share Trends by 2032

The Artificial Intelligence (AI) sensor market is poised to revolutionize industries across the globe, driven by the rapid integration of AI technologies into everyday devices and systems. AI sensors, which combine traditional sensor capabilities with advanced machine learning algorithms, are enabling smarter decision-making, enhanced automation, and unprecedented levels of efficiency. From healthcare and automotive to manufacturing and consumer electronics, the applications of AI sensors are vast and transformative. As the world moves toward a more connected and intelligent future, the AI sensor market is emerging as a critical enabler of this technological evolution.

Market Size and Growth Projections

The Artificial Intelligence (AI) Sensor Market Size was valued at USD 3.9 billion in 2023 and is expected to reach a staggering USD 98.7 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 43.06% from 2024 to 2032. This exponential growth is fueled by the increasing adoption of AI-driven technologies across various sectors, the proliferation of Internet of Things (IoT) devices, and the demand for real-time data processing and analytics. The market's rapid expansion underscores the critical role AI sensors play in enabling smarter, more efficient systems and applications.

Key Drivers of Market Growth

Several factors are contributing to the remarkable growth of the AI sensor market. One of the primary drivers is the rising demand for automation and smart technologies across industries. In the automotive sector, for instance, AI sensors are integral to the development of autonomous vehicles, enabling features such as object detection, collision avoidance, and adaptive cruise control. Similarly, in healthcare, AI sensors are being used in wearable devices to monitor vital signs, predict health issues, and provide personalized treatment recommendations.

The proliferation of IoT devices is another significant factor driving market growth. As more devices become connected, the need for intelligent sensors capable of processing and analyzing data in real-time is increasing. AI sensors are uniquely positioned to meet this demand, offering enhanced capabilities such as predictive maintenance, anomaly detection, and energy optimization.

Advancements in AI and machine learning algorithms are also playing a crucial role in the market's expansion. These advancements are enabling AI sensors to become more accurate, efficient, and capable of handling complex tasks. Additionally, the decreasing cost of sensor components and the increasing availability of high-speed connectivity are making AI sensors more accessible to a wider range of industries and applications.

Applications Across Industries

The versatility of AI sensors is evident in their wide range of applications across various industries. In the automotive sector, AI sensors are driving the development of autonomous vehicles and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S). These sensors enable vehicles to perceive their surroundings, make real-time decisions, and navigate safely without human intervention.

In healthcare, AI sensors are transforming patient care by enabling continuous monitoring and early detection of health issues. Wearable devices equipped with AI sensors can track vital signs, detect anomalies, and provide actionable insights to both patients and healthcare providers. This not only improves patient outcomes but also reduces healthcare costs by preventing complications and hospitalizations.

The manufacturing industry is also benefiting from the adoption of AI sensors. These sensors are being used to optimize production processes, monitor equipment health, and predict maintenance needs. By leveraging AI sensors, manufacturers can reduce downtime, improve efficiency, and enhance product quality.

In the consumer electronics sector, AI sensors are enhancing the functionality of devices such as smartphones, smart home appliances, and wearable gadgets. These sensors enable features such as facial recognition, voice control, and gesture recognition, providing users with a more intuitive and seamless experience.

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ite the significant growth potential, the AI sensor market faces several challenges. One of the primary challenges is the high cost of developing and deploying AI sensor technologies. Additionally, concerns related to data privacy and security pose significant hurdles, particularly in industries such as healthcare and automotive, where sensitive data is involved.

However, these challenges also present opportunities for innovation and growth. Companies that can develop cost-effective and secure AI sensor solutions are likely to gain a competitive edge in the market. Furthermore, the increasing focus on sustainability and energy efficiency is driving the demand for AI sensors that can optimize resource usage and reduce environmental impact.

Future Outlook

The future of the AI sensor market looks incredibly promising, with continued advancements in AI, machine learning, and IoT technologies expected to drive further growth. As industries increasingly adopt AI-driven solutions, the demand for intelligent sensors will continue to rise. The market is also likely to witness increased collaboration between technology providers, sensor manufacturers, and end-users, leading to the development of more innovative and tailored solutions.

Powertrain Sensor Market Size Forecast and Share Analysis: Trends to Watch by 2032

The automotive industry is undergoing a transformative phase, driven by advancements in technology, increasing demand for fuel efficiency, and stringent emission regulations. At the heart of this transformation lies the powertrain sensor market, a critical component of modern vehicles that ensures optimal performance, efficiency, and compliance with environmental standards. Powertrain sensors play a pivotal role in monitoring and controlling various aspects of a vehicle's engine, transmission, and drivetrain, making them indispensable in today's automotive landscape.

Market Size and Growth Projections

The Powertrain Sensor Market Size was valued at USD 21.52 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 27.84 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.9% during the forecast period from 2024 to 2032. This steady growth is fueled by the increasing adoption of advanced sensor technologies, the rise of electric and hybrid vehicles, and the growing emphasis on vehicle safety and performance. As automotive manufacturers continue to innovate, the demand for high-precision powertrain sensors is expected to surge, driving market expansion over the next decade.

Key Drivers of Market Growth

Rise of Electric and Hybrid Vehicles: The global shift toward electric and hybrid vehicles is one of the primary factors driving the powertrain sensor market. These vehicles rely heavily on sensors to monitor battery performance, motor efficiency, and energy consumption. As governments worldwide implement policies to reduce carbon emissions, the ad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) is expected to accelerate, further boosting the demand for powertrain sensors.

Stringent Emission Regulations: Governments and regulatory bodies across the globe are imposing stricter emission standards to combat environmental pollution. Powertrain sensors are essential for ensuring compliance with these regulations by optimizing engine performance and reducing harmful emissions. This has led to increased integration of sensors in both conventional and alternative fuel vehicles.

Advancements in Sensor Technology: Technological innovations, such as the development of smart sensors and the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and the Internet of Things (IoT), are revolutionizing the powertrain sensor market. These advancements enable real-time data analysis, predictive maintenance, and enhanced vehicle performance, making sensors more efficient and reliable.

Growing Demand for Vehicle Safety and Performance: Consumers are increasingly prioritizing safety and performance when purchasing vehicles. Powertrain sensors contribute to improved vehicle dynamics, fuel efficiency, and overall driving experience. This has led to their widespread adoption in both passenger and commercial vehicles.

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ite the positive growth trajectory, the powertrain sensor market faces certain challenges. High manufacturing costs and the complexity of integrating advanced sensors into existing systems can hinder market growth. Additionally, the need for continuous innovation to meet evolving industry standards poses a challenge for manufacturers.

However, these challenges also present opportunities for market players. Investing in research and development to create cost-effective and high-performance sensors can help companies gain a competitive edge. Furthermore, the growing demand for autonomous vehicles and connected car technologies opens new avenues for the application of powertrain sensors.

Regional Insights

The powertrain sensor market is geographically diverse, with significant growth observed in regions such as North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. North America and Europe are leading the market due to the presence of major automotive manufacturers and stringent emission norms. Meanwhile, Asia-Pacific is expected to witness the fastest growth, driven by the increasing production of vehicles and the rising adoption of electric vehicles in countries like China and India.

Conclusion

The powertrain sensor market is poised for substantial growth over the next decade, driven by technological advancements, regulatory requirements, and the shift toward sustainable mobility. As the automotive industry continues to evolve, powertrain sensors will remain a critical component, enabling vehicles to achieve higher levels of efficiency, safety, and performance. With a projected market value of USD 27.84 billion by 2032, the powertrain sensor market represents a significant opportunity for stakeholders across the automotive ecosystem. Companies that invest in innovation and adapt to changing market dynamics will be well-positioned to capitalize on this growth and shape the future of mobility.

Smart Agriculture Market Size Forecast: Trends, Share, and Opportunities by 2032

The global agricultural sector is undergoing a transformative shift, driven by the rapid adoption of advanced technologies. Smart agriculture, also known as precision farming, is at the forefront of this revolution, leveraging innovations such as the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), drones, and big data analytics to optimize farming practices. This evolution is not only enhancing productivity but also addressing critical challenges such as food security, climate change, and resource scarcity. As the world’s population continues to grow, the demand for sustainable and efficient agricultural practices has never been more urgent.

Market Size and Growth Projections

The Smart Agriculture Market Size has already demonstrated significant growth, with its size valued at USD 16.1 billion in 2023. This growth trajectory is expected to accelerate over the next decade, with the market projected to reach USD 36.73 billion by 2032. This repres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.6% during the forecast period of 2024–2032. The increasing adoption of precision farming technologies, coupled with the need to maximize crop yields and minimize environmental impact, is driving this expansion. Governments, private enterprises, and farmers alike are investing heavily in smart agriculture solutions to ensure a sustainable future for food production.

Key Drivers of Smart Agriculture Adoption

Several factors are contributing to the rapid growth of the smart agriculture market. One of the primary drivers is the rising global population, which is expected to reach nearly 10 billion by 2050. This demographic shift is creating unprecedented demand for food, necessitating more efficient and scalable farming methods. Additionally, climate change is posing significant challenges to traditional agriculture, with unpredictable weather patterns and resource depletion threatening crop yields. Smart agriculture technologies offer a solution by enabling farmers to monitor and manage their fields with precision, reducing waste and optimizing resource use.

Another critical factor is the increasing availability and affordability of advanced technologies. IoT-enabled sensors, drones, and AI-powered analytics tools are becoming more accessible to farmers, even in developing regions. These technologies provide real-time data on soil conditions, weather patterns, and crop health, allowing farmers to make informed decisions and improve productivity. Furthermore, government initiatives and subsidies aimed at promoting sustainable farming practices are encouraging the adoption of smart agriculture solutions worldwide.

Applications and Benefits of Smart Agriculture

Smart agriculture encompasses a wide range of applications, each designed to address specific challenges in the farming process. Precision farming, for instance, uses GPS and IoT sensors to monitor field conditions and apply inputs such as water, fertilizers, and pesticides with pinpoint accuracy. This not only reduces costs but also minimizes environmental impact. Similarly, drone technology is being used for crop monitoring, pest control, and even planting, significantly reducing labor requirements and improving efficiency.

Livestock monitoring is another key application of smart agriculture. IoT-enabled devices can track the health and behavior of animals, enabling early detection of diseases and improving overall herd management. Additionally, smart irrigation systems are helping farmers conserve water by delivering the right amount of moisture to crops based on real-time data. These innovations are not only boosting productivity but also promoting sustainability, making smart agriculture a win-win solution for farmers and the environment.

Challenges and Future Outlook

Despite its immense potential, the smart agriculture market faces several challenges. High initial costs and a lack of technical expertise among farmers, particularly in developing regions, can hinder adoption. Additionally, concerns about data privacy and cybersecurity pose risks to the widespread implementation of IoT and AI technologies in agriculture. However, ongoing advancements in technology and increasing awareness of the benefits of smart agriculture are expected to overcome these barriers over time.

Looking ahead, the smart agriculture market is poised for exponential growth, driven by the convergence of technology and sustainability. As the world grapples with the dual challenges of feeding a growing population and protecting the planet, smart agriculture offers a promising path forward. By harnessing the power of innovation, the agricultural sector can achieve greater efficiency, resilience, and sustainability, ensuring food security for generations to come.
